4280/’13
Hon. Dunesh Gankanda,— To ask the Prime Minister and Minister of Buddha Sasana and Religious Affairs,—
(a) Will he inform this House of—
(i) the number of complaints lodged with the Commission to Investigate Allegations of Bribery or Corruption against Ministers (Cabinet and Non Cabinet), Deputy Ministers and Members of Parliament, within the period from 19th November 2005 to 30th June 2013;
(ii) the names of the Ministers, Deputy Ministers and Members of Parliament against whom such allegations have been leveled; and
(iii) the allegations leveled against each Minister, Deputy Minister and Member of Parliament separately?
(b) Will he also inform this House—
(i) of the number of complaints with regard to which investigations have been concluded by the said Commission;
(ii) of further action taken in relation to complaints with regard to which investigations have been concluded separately;
(iii) whether speedy and proper investigations will be carried out regarding the complaints with regard to which investigations have not been concluded up to now; and
(iv) the time frame envisaged for that?
(c) If not, why?
